underhanded 音标拼音: ['ʌndɚh'ændɪd] a. 秘密的,卑劣的,人手不足的 秘密的,卑劣的,人手不足的 underhanded adj 1: marked by deception; " achieved success in business only by underhand methods" [ synonym: { sneaky}, { underhand}, { underhanded}] 2: with hand brought forward and up from below shoulder level; " an underhand pitch"; " an underhand stroke" [ synonym: { underhand}, { underhanded}, { underarm}] [ ant: { overarm}, { overhand}, { overhanded}] Underhanded \ Un" der* hand` ed\, a. 1. Underhand; clandestine. [ 1913 Webster] 2. Insufficiently provided with hands or workers; short- handed; sparsely populated; obsolete in this sense, { short- handed} or { understaffed} being the preferrred term. [ 1913 Webster JG] Norway . . . might defy the world, . . . but it is much underhanded now. -- Coleridge.
